ZnO Nanopowder For Rubber Zinc oxide has a wide use in rubber processing. This is due to the fact that this compound of zinc can modify the properties of rubber in many useful ways, and all these applications have been found to be useful in industries. Rubber has an extensive use in industry. Although automobiles are the largest consumer of rubber products, they are not the only consumer of rubber. Rubber products also find usage in medical equipment, toys, sports and some other areas.
ZnO Nanopowder for Rubber However, ZnO is the most widely used material in automobile tyre manufacturing. In fact, ZnO Nanopowder for Rubber is indispensable in tyre manufacturing. Although ZnO is used mostly as an activator in the reaction between Sulphur and Zinc during vulcanization of rubber, this is not the only use of this compound. Apart from acting as an activator, the unreacted portion of ZnO is available as a reserve which can neutralize the acidic decomposition products arising out of the presence of sulfur. In fact, the use of ZnO Nanopowder is multifaceted. It also helps with chemical reinforcement of rubber and makes rubber resistant to heat, aging and compression fatigue. Zinc Oxide is used as a crosslinking agent for rubber in various industrial applications. Owing to its crosslinking property it also works as an accelerator with some elastomers. ZnO can enhance the mechanical properties of rubber. This includes hardness, tensile strength, tear etc. However, there are some drawbacks of using ZnO too. It can also make rubber poor scorch resistant, low flexibility, very high compression etc. Yet, owing to its crosslinking ability with rubber, it is widely used as an accelerator and co-accelerator in vulcanization of rubber. ZnO Nanopowder also finds use in preservation of latex since it can prevent latex from reacting with enzymes and degrade the material. ZnO can also be used as a fungicide to prevent the growth of not only fungi, but also mold, mildew etc. Rubber is the most preferred insulating material for use in high voltage cable installations. Here too ZnO has a vital role to play. The ZnO Nanopowder is inherently a dielectric material which can prevent corona effect in high voltage cables. It can resist corona effect and thus make long distance transmission of electricity possible without disastrous consequences. Moreover, it can help rubber preserve its properties at high temperatures by preventing its decomposition. Other Uses of Zno Nanopowder This nanopowder is also used to make rubber stable to heat. This can make rubber suitable for various usages such as in making vehicle tyres which are likely to subject to high heat such as in commercial vehicles. ZnO Nanopowder can make vehicle tyres stable at high temperatures. ZnO also helps with latex gelation and this is pretty useful in rubber processing. It can stabilize the latex foam used for manufacturing mattresses. ZnO also offers stability to rubber from UV lights since it has the unique property of absorbing Ultra Violate lights. It can stabilize rubber if it is exposed to UV rays for a long time. It is also used for pigmentation of rubber as it can enhance rubber health because of its high refractive index and brightness. It also makes rubber very white and this finds wide use in making surgical gloves, rubber sheets etc. ZnO is also useful in making synthetic rubbers like chloreprenes, polysulfides etc. It can also make rubber more conductive to heat and help in rapid heat dissipation.
